I was given a six month post operative protocol.. Inflate once a day to mild discomfort which I am observing. I was wondering what if any protocol I should use after 6 months? My doctor had me inflated 60-70 percent for 2 weeks after surgery. I expect the inflated cylinders cut off blood flow to any remaining erectile tissue. I am totally dependent on the cylinders for any erection.
My question is do I need to regularly inflate the device to maintain size and health.?. How often? For how long? Do I run the risk of wear on the device and speed the need for revision. Those of you with long term experience please advise

I got my Titan in 2008 and have never used it (see signature). I asked Dr. Kramer about inflating, and he advised me to "inflate it every now and then to keep things stretched and healthy." I inflate mine every couple of months for a minute or so, and every time it seems to be just fine.
